Just a heads up that Usagi Yojimbo NR 100 will hit the stands on January 31, 2007! This issue will feature story and art by guest creators Mark Evanier & Scott Shaw!, Publisher Mike Richardson & Rick Geary, Former UY Editor Jamie Rich & Andi Watson, Guy Davis, Sergio Aragones, Jeff Smith, Matt Wagner, Frank Miller and, of course, Tom Luth did the cover colors (ensuring the entire Groo Crew is represented -- how wrong would that be if they weren't??). Editor Diana Schutz may do a page, and Stan himself will do 7-8 pages to bookend the other contributors. It will be a 32 pager, with a $3.50 cover price, wraparound cover on card stock, and b&w interiors.

You can read more about it at the UYD's "Coming Up in UY" page here: http://usagiyojimbo.com/comingup.html We've also got a few preview pages!

There will also be a signed print of UY 100 offered in limited edition. A comic book retailer gets a free print for every 15 copies of UY 100 they order. So get in touch with your local store owners and let them know you want one asap! There is no set price, so wheel and deal if you can (who knows -- if you're in good with them, they may give it to you for free!). According to Stan, who just recently started signing them, they are beautiful. The print is about 18x24 inches, the printing is very good, and on excellent paper. The quality is almost as good as the Dragon print, which sold for $100. This one is sure to be a serious collector's item you don't want to miss out on!
